服务器作为现代信息系统的核心组件,承载着数据存储、应用运行和网络服务等重要功能。然而,服务器故障却是一个常见且令人头疼的问题,可能导致业务中断、数据丢失甚至经济损失。那么,服务器故障的原因究竟有哪些呢?本文将从硬件、软件、环境和人为因素四个方面进行分析。
1. 硬件故障
硬件故障是服务器故障的常见原因之一。服务器硬件包括CPU、内存、硬盘、电源、主板等组件,任何一个部件的损坏都可能导致服务器无法正常运行。例如:
- 硬盘故障:硬盘是存储数据的核心部件,长时间运行或受到震动可能导致硬盘损坏,从而引发数据丢失或系统崩溃。
- 电源问题:电源不稳定或电源模块损坏会导致服务器突然断电,影响业务连续性。
- 散热不良:服务器长时间高负载运行,如果散热系统(如风扇、散热片)出现问题,可能导致硬件过热,进而引发故障。
2. 软件问题
软件层面的问题也是服务器故障的重要原因。服务器操作系统、应用程序或配置不当都可能引发故障。例如:
- 系统漏洞:未及时修补的操作系统漏洞可能被黑客利用,导致服务器被攻击或数据泄露。
- 资源耗尽:服务器内存、CPU等资源被过度占用,可能导致系统响应缓慢甚至崩溃。
- 配置错误:错误的网络配置、权限设置或数据库参数调整可能导致服务无法正常运行。
3. 环境因素
服务器运行的环境对其稳定性有着重要影响。以下是一些常见的环境因素:
- 电力问题:电压不稳或突然断电可能导致服务器硬件损坏或数据丢失。
- 温度过高:服务器机房温度过高会加速硬件老化,甚至引发火灾等严重事故。
- 湿度过高或过低:湿度过高可能导致硬件短路,湿度过低则可能产生静电,损坏电子元件。
4. 人为因素
人为操作失误或管理不当也是服务器故障的重要原因。例如:
- 误操作:管理员在维护服务器时误删文件、错误配置或执行不当命令,可能导致服务中断。
- 缺乏维护:未定期检查服务器状态、清理冗余数据或更新系统补丁,可能使服务器面临更高的故障风险。
- 安全意识不足:未设置强密码、未启用防火墙或未定期备份数据,可能导致服务器被攻击或数据丢失。
总结
服务器故障的原因多种多样,既有硬件和软件层面的问题,也有环境和人为因素的影响。为了减少服务器故障的发生,企业需要采取以下措施:
- 定期检查硬件状态,及时更换老化或损坏的部件。
- 保持系统和应用程序的更新,修补已知漏洞。
- 确保服务器运行环境的稳定性,包括电力、温度和湿度等。
- 加强人员培训,提高操作规范性和安全意识。
- 制定完善的应急预案,确保在故障发生时能够快速恢复服务。
通过以上措施,可以有效降低服务器故障的风险,保障业务的连续性和数据的安全性。